Aquarium in Gdynia is a unique place in the city center, ideal for both children and adults. This is a Polish museum of the Sea Fisheries Institute with the status of the zoo. It is located in Gdynia on the South Pier in a modernist building, Marine Station, which was built in 1938 and modernized in 1969. You can see 215 unique species of fish, amphibians and reptiles from different parts of the world, eg. from Africa, North America and the North of our continent.
